Heat Shield Above First 90
WARNING
Fire Risk.
Installation of this appliance may require the
use of heat shield 385-290 above the fi rst 90
elbow in the venting system.
• Heat shield required if vertical distance between top of
horizontal elbow and any combustible surface above
elbow is less than 4 inches.
• Heat shield not required if distance is more than 4
inches.

Fasten the shield in place using the four pilot holes pro-
vided in the part.
• Position the shield so the longest dimension (13 1/2 inch)
is placed in same direction the elbow is pointing.
• Center the shield directly above the elbow with a 1/2
inch air space between shield and combustible surface
(see Figure 6.3).
